The concept
Adaptive light control is a variable headlamp control system that enables dynamic illumination of the road surface.
Depending on the steering angle and other parameters, the light from the headlamp follows the course of the road.
In tight curves, e.g., on mountainous roads or when turning, one of the two front fog lamps is switched on as a turning lamp. As a result the inside of the curve is better lighted.
